As the water at the ocean’s surface approaches the north or south pole, it becomes colder and denser and then sinks. When the water sinks, it transports oxygen pulled from Earth’s atmosphere down to the ocean floor. Nonetheless, it remains challenging to precisely handle the content of sodium-containing species which originate from the precipitation agent used for co-precipitation. Evaporation of the sodium at higher temperatures will result in a loss of this stabilizing agent, which might deteriorate the components more than extended redox cycles. For the duration of lengthy-term thermochemical redox-cycling, sodium tends to react with Al2O3 and form a variety of species (i.e. NaxAlyOz)40. It is desirable to tune the synthetic chemistry of the LDH precursors to reduce the formation of sodium-containing impurities and attain a far more steady lengthy-term cycling efficiency. Researchers envision that a scaled-up version of MOXIE could be sent to Mars ahead of a human mission, to constantly generate oxygen at the rate of various hundred trees. At that capacity, the system should really create enough oxygen to both sustain humans as soon as they arrive, and fuel a rocket for returning astronauts back to Earth. Day and night, and across seasons, the instrument generates breathable oxygen from the Red Planet’s thin atmosphere.
